SK Brann enters this Eliteserien matchup as the clear favorite due to superior league standing and recent results, sitting fifth with ten points while Aalesunds FK languishes in 16th with just three. Brann’s strong away form and recent 2-1 win over KFUM Oslo contrast with Aalesund’s inconsistent run that includes multiple defeats. Historical head-to-head records further tilt sentiment, as Brann has claimed the last three encounters, including a cup victory three weeks ago. Aalesund’s home fixture at Color Line Stadion offers some counterbalance through familiarity and potential crowd support, yet ongoing squad issues like forward S. Magnusson’s meniscus injury limit their ability to challenge effectively. Traders price these factors into the current implied probabilities, reflecting Brann’s edge in overall team momentum and depth.
